textformfield dropdown flutter. dropdownRadius # define the radius of dropdown List ,default value is 12. textformfield dropdown flutter

 
 dropdownRadius # define the radius of dropdown List ,default value is 12textformfield dropdown flutter  Follow asked Oct 6, 2020 at 7:40

)Flutter/Dart how to pick a date and populate text field with selection. But if you still want focus to this text field you can follow below code: TextFormField ( showCursor: true,//add this line readOnly: true ) And if you want hide text pointer (cursor), you need set enableInteractiveSelection to false. 1. The value returns to the initial state setwhen you. The border, labels, icons, and styles used to decorate a Material Design text field. Keep Learning!!! Keep Fluttering!!! If you are confused about something in flutter!! Do let us know, we would love to assist 🙂. center, enabled: true, initialValue. Provides validation of data. Screenshots # Installing # To use this package: Run this command: flutter pub add intl_phone. Step 2: Add the material package that gives us the. Inside the DropdownButton, add the value parameter and assign the dropdownValue that we created in step 1. To remove Color from TextFormField use fillColor and filled property on TextFormField. Create a button to validate and submit the form. – Vineeth Mohan. of (context). final List<String> myCoolStrings = ['Item 1', 'Item 2', 'Item 3', 'Item 4', 'Some other item']; Create our local search. final val = TextSelection. Provides validation of data. Although DropdownButtonFormField widget doesn't have focusNode property, you can wrap this widget with Focus and a Listener to achieve the desired result. when we do padding to InputFields, it wont work properly (i dont know why but i have experienced). I have layout issues because the text from the dropdown menu that you choose can't fit inside the TextFormField and I can't seem to fix this issue. The Form allows one to save, reset, or validate multiple fields at once. this message will display on button click. and remove. 1. Use a TextEditingController. Setting up the pet type chooser. I am new to Flutter. I have tried to use Padding and SizedBox but none is realy working. Create a Dropdown widget - DropdownButton. Provide the following code inside the TextField widget and change the color according to the background color of a TextField. You can style the widget using the decoration. . The hint is Displayed if the value is null. selection = val;1 Answer. 16. Here, we see that TextFormField extends a FormField<T> . with this button the user can add as many form fields as they need. forEach ( (i) { var textEditingController = new TextEditingController (); textEditingControllers. . Focus a TextField by tapping it. Flutter: change border color for Outlined button. This is a convenience widget that wraps a TextField widget in a FormField. so initially there is no form but an add button. Both fields were wrapped in Flexible widgets within the Row, with mainAxisSize set to MainAxisSize. How do I achieve the following look for a Row which consists of a dropdown and a TextFormField? I am able to customize the TextFormField using the following code: final phoneNumberBox = DecoratedBox ( decoration: const BoxDecoration (color: Color (0x2B8E8E93), borderRadius:BorderRadius. Jan 30, 2020 at 20:47InputDecoration. Share. The DropdownButton widget contains several required properties we need to make dropdown functional. It will provide wide range of various search functionality in. DropdownButton. Flutter's core Dropdown Button widget with steady dropdown menu and many other options you can customize to your needs. It is a property that flutter provides with TextField. How can I change the height of a DropdownButton in flutter. 4,925 15 15 gold badges 66 66 silver badges 108 108 bronze badges. Provides requirement of the field. This is what i have so far. 998. but this does not work. Learn more about TeamsI'm trying to create an "Edit Profile" page where I'm loading all the user data and letting the user modify it. TextFormField ( initialValue: 'initial value' ) To clear the text you can use _controller. . Add the following line in your pubspec. runtimeType → Type A representation of the runtime type of the object. 92, child: TextFormField( onChanged: (value) {}, onSaved: (value) {},), ), What i need to achive is this. Flutter dropdown background color customization. The default DropdownButton with DropdownMenuItems returns a light-grey dropdown. Flutter provides two text fields: TextField and TextFormField. A region is the USA equivalent of a state and a district is a sub location within a region. i. im sure flutter will update these limitations so i just went with your option #2 together with a TextFormField but the dropdownbutton's Text (labelText) will be a bit higher than the. The default value shows the currently selected value. The Form allows one to save, reset, or validate multiple fields at once. Below are the steps explaining the use of the controller. We can perform any operation on that user input data using TextFormField. Seems good option but I cant set the suffix always visible, it disappears without focus! Else For Simple user input capture TextField is sufficient. I want the value to be selected only from google mab. Drop down inside text field flutter. Because I am creating a controller for it. insert (overlayEntry); // call remove when there is nothing to show. Simple and intuitive to use in the app. Remember to have a Stateful Widget. To use without a Form , pass a GlobalKey<FormFieldState> (see GlobalKey) to the constructor and use. You can achieve that using DropDownButtonFormField widget instead of DropDownButton. A region dropdown field and a district dropdown field. My problems: When the user selects a value in the dropdown, all the values in the other generated dropdown fields changes to the. 1. This widget can be used to make customised text field to take phone number input for any country along with an option to choose country code from a dropdown. It is used to get user input in a variety of forms such as email, password, phone, home address, etc. Follows the app theme and colors. You have to go to the dropdown. The following code enable and toggles the show/hide text by pressing the "eye" button on the far right. you can call the code from wherever and whenever it will set the cursor location when it is called. harunB10 harunB10. To mask the user input, select the TextField widget, move to the Properties Panel > Additional Properties > set the Mask dropdown to the one you need. Is there any other way to archive this? my codes are here, Thanks in advance for your guidance. Provides requirement of the field. Autocomplete. roxifas commented on Dec 16, 2019. Modified 2 years, 2 months ago. READ MORE. A Form ancestor is not required. Rename DropDownButton to FixedDropDownButton so it does not conflict with Flutter imports. Flutter DropdownTextfield # A DropdownTextfield is a material design TextField. Simple to implement. I created dropdown in TextFormField in flutter, i successfully loaded list (bankDataList) into dropdown which is dynamic list. . Viewed 1k times. [searchWidget] is use to show the text box for the searching. I have dropdown menu it has problem, the problem is when i select some value or index like index 4 (Rating) the menu of dropdown list will goes up ex: picture number 2, what i want to tried is even i select index 4 (rating) or other index the dropdown menu list still on same line with search box the dropdown menu go up. TextFormField is the basic widget we use in our app. TextFormField in one container and ListTiles in another container and overlaying the listtile as user types on the container of text input field. I know this is a time of LOCKDOWN. Use overlay. TextFormField in. dotted. See the below code:3. How to set dropdown selected item into TextFormField in Flutter. My text field was laid out to the left of the dropdown. Simple to implement. class. none, ) To disable every border on the width, set InputBorder. 2. void showOverlay (BuildContext context) { // in builder write a function that return your dropdown text widgets which are positioned under your textfield OverlayEntry overlayEntry = OverlayEntry (builder: _build); Overlay. Other things you should know about this widget are; The widget should be used inside a form field widget. To fix the issue, we first need to set a value on each DropdownMenuItem (so that something could be passed to onChanged callback): return DropdownMenuItem ( child: new Text (location), value: location, ); The app will still fail. Today I tried to design a dropdown button with customized items in it where I can select all items or deselect all items with one click. FocusScope. how to show flutter search textfield without click. Hey @Momoro you can use this code if you don't want to pass a static height to your TextFormField if minLines is 1 and maxlines is 2 then a single line TextFormField will be visible and its height will be increased dynamically while user writes more words in the field . content_copy. If you go with a DropdownButton, when you focus the TextFormField and then you tap the DropdownButton, the keyboard will be dismissed. Flutter 0. For my other selections I am using a TextFormField but when I try to put the dropdown in a box decoration it. . And the DropdownButtonFormField widget is a convenience widget that wraps the Dropdown widget and allows you to change the visual aesthetic and add validations on the. Questions : Flutter dropdown text field 2023-10-26T14:36:26+00:00 2023-10-26T14:36:26+00:00. Q&A for work. T. Open the dropdown. ·. How do I prevent the PopupMenu from disappearing when I press space bar within the TextField in it in Flutter Web? 0. There is now a way to disable TextField and TextFormField. 3. Keyboard disappearing right after appearing. Using Controller: Another way to retrieve text is by using the controller. keyboard_arrow_down_rounded), iconSize: 40, iconDisabledColor: Colors. This example shows how to create a TextField that will obscure input. So in this article, We Have Been through How to Remove Underline From DropDownButtonForm Field In Flutter. In this tutorial, we’ll learn how to properly use Flutter textformfield controller by using a practical Flutter code example. Instead they appear as keyboard hints, but even when I tap on the keyboard hint, nothing happens. – Desmon. DropdownMenuItem. final DateTime picked = await showDatePicker (. Flutter how i can put custom widget to. The most basic form of validation can be seen in the example here. 1. More. Instead of using a TextFormField that catch the tap at the place of the GestureDetector I use a simple child Text of the InputDecorator widget. We’ve explored the fundamentals of the DropdownButton and DropdownMenuItem widget in Flutter. To use this package: Run this command: flutter pub add intl_phone_fieldFirst of all you need to use an HTTP client package like Dio or tttp. how to display "this field is required" message out from the box. Wrap your entire app with the DismissKeyboard widget we’ve made before, like this: This ensures. Seeing the screen above. text. In this example, we are going to show you how to add placeholder or hint text on TextField or TextFormField in Flutter App. This will create the dropdown menu item for each object of list. Adding list of items using TextFormField in Flutter. Flutter customize dropdown + TextFormField. Flutter : How to center an icon next to hint text inside an input. The TextField and TextFormField widgets in Flutter are the most used widgets. I am making an application where I have to write my location in text form field and from server it fetches the data and show us the similar words related to the words in drop down list and I can choose from that list or can write a complete new location in text form field, if it is not present in that drop down list. A customised Flutter TextFormField to input international phone number along with country code. add ( new Column ( children: [ new DropdownButton. To display the selected items, this widget can be used alongside your own button or it can be specified as a chipDisplay parameter of widgets like MultiSelectDialogField. You can use the decoration's constraints parameter: decoration: const InputDecoration ( constraints: BoxConstraints (maxHeight: 50, minHeight: 50), labelText: "Your Label") Share. currentState. Steps: Add the TextFormField widget. icon: const Icon (Icons. To create a local project with this code sample, run: flutter create -. This country code picker in flutter widget can be used to make a customized text field to take phone number input for any country along with an option to choose country code from a dropdown. Sorry for late answer you need to add following code in onTapListener of DropDownButton Widget. Q&A for work. TextFormField. bold, fontSize: 23, wordSpacing: 4. I am trying to use a checkbox to show/hide 2 textformfields in Flutter. Dependencies. In this blog post, let’s check how to add a simple drop down menu in flutter. I am making an application where I have to write my location in text form field and from server it fetches the data and show us the similar words related to the. constructor. 1 Answer. It has important attributes such as value, items, onChanged etc. For example, calling FormState. This is being caused because in your Widget build function you have a FocusScope. API reference. text. To display the default value, move to the Initial Configuration section and enter the value. 5 (and still the same in 2. For a description of the onSaved, validator, or autovalidateMode. 0. I have tried adding the overflow: TextOverflow. A TextFormField has additional properties such as validation, decoration, and formatting, making it ideal for use in forms where user. Learn more about TeamsTo change the dropdown button color: Wrap your DropdownButton inside the Container . final. The type we need for a TextFormField is String . Create a stateful widget class for our form. However, TextField doesn't have an intrinsic width; it only knows how to size itself to the full width. black. this message will display on button click. yaml file to add intl package to your project. TextFormField; DropdownFormField; TextFormField. Teams. When used inside a Form, you can use methods on FormState to query or manipulate the form data as a whole. 3 Answers. Drop down fields We now need a way for the user to enter their expiry information. pink, If you want to remove the border of dropdown button in. Supply an onChanged () callback to a. 1. When used inside a Form, you can use methods on FormState to query or manipulate the form data as a whole. The date or time picked is shown in a Material TextFormField widget. A flutter package to select a country from a list of countries. 10 Nov. A region dropdown field and. Here’s an example: Here’s an example: SizedBox( height: 60, // set desired height here child: TextFormField( decoration: InputDecoration( labelText: 'Enter your name', border: OutlineInputBorder(), ), ), ),2. Inside the Container, add the decoration property and assign the BoxDecoration widget. This short article walks you through a few examples of customizing the borders of a TextField (or TextFormField) widget in Flutter. Yes, sure, you can inject list of cities into this dropdown. However, I recently came across a situation where the options had to be styled. 0. ellipsis property but that only changes for the dropdown labels, still when I choose one, they can't fit inside the TextFormField. To add these field we will use a simple widgets that will provide us with the basic graphics of the material design, this widget is called TextFormField. 2 how to restrict choose date. Is there an programming example of a material dropdown list text Learning field? I saw the example on Material Earhost Text Field but I didn't find anywhere in most effective the documentation on how to implement wrong. Here's how it looks: Dropdown widget. >. of (context). Wrapping up. The field that will contain our password will have an extra property "obscureText" to show the black dotted chars instead of the actual visible password. First I created a class to group them together. Sample working code below: return DropdownButtonFormField<String> ( decoration: InputDecoration. TDN TDN. 1. description DropdownButtonFormField<T> class A FormField that contains a DropdownButton. Sorry for late answer you need to add following code in onTapListener of DropDownButton Widget. Users tap on the item and I pop the new page open which has a DropdownButton, a TextFormField, and a save button. 0. An item in a menu created by a DropdownButton. The keyboard that appears doesn't show "next" (which should shift the focus to next field) field action instead it is. To create a local project with this code sample, run: flutter create --sample=material. I removed Container from your CardHolderTextField. As of flutter 1. How to set initial default value in drop down flutter. ; This takes a validator function argument that we can use to specify our validation logic. Viewed 4k times 0 Im new, I trying to do a onchange value while typing in text field, the value are updating the Text widget. We’ve implemented a simple Flutter textformfield widget and have passed the specified text controller to the controller constructor of textformfield class. 0. Screenshots. here when I am select the value from drop down the country code text field value is changed based on drop-down item is selected, in this example I have some static value when I am selecting the USA from drop-down value the country code value is automatically changed +1 and when I am selecting India from drop-down the country. I'm using floatingActionButton to increase TextForm Fields. Features Options Installation. When you press. dart. circular (32), bottomRight. I prefer using stack. text = stringData; this will set the stringData to the TextField or TextFormField which the Correo controller assigned to. Can anyone help me to get this type of result. The main required property is the item property. 2. dart provided with the flutter package. I have copied part of the example here for easier reference: // This class holds data related to the. TextFormField( decoration: const InputDecoration( border: UnderlineInputBorder(), labelText: 'Enter your username', ), ), A FormField that contains a DropdownButton. You should add 'd'This example shows how to create an Autocomplete widget whose options are fetched over the network. Q&A for work. CupertinoTextFormFieldRow. Follows the app theme and colors. The first thing I need the app to do is to take an Address/location as input from the user. If you're using VSCode Ctrl+Click on the DrpoDownMenuItem class and change the following code. This image shows flutter app selection controls. The Checkbox itself does toggle between true and false but there is no change in the layout. 0. It is the Flutter widget that is the combination of the dropdown widget and a formfield. In this article, I will be changing the Flutter dropdown background color with proper implementation using Flutter example code. If I try on the form field, I can't use the controllers. Create a function to print the latest value. You said that you would like to style your drop down yourself, I suspect that this is the reason why you decided against the standard. About; Products For Teams; Stack. But I couldn't place a drop-down button inside a text form field. In this post, we will discuss how to create a dynamic dropdown form field in flutter. Flutterでドロップダウン(プルダウン)のボタンってどうやって表示するんだろう?. If anyone's searching for a different solution to change its height, besides changing the Theme. I try to find a solution, but I can't find it and I am not able to program it by myself. collapsed (offset: _textTEC. I've mentioned in the question that when user will click on GPS button then this field of dropdown shows the city name achieved from GPS tracking. requestFocus (new FocusNode ()); Share. You can achieve that using DropDownButtonFormField widget instead of DropDownButton. But I couldn't find a way to do that. It lets the user select one value from a number of items. copyWith (color:. Documentation. "Error: Cannot hit test a render box that has never been laid out. Or you can use TextFormField so you don't have to use a controller. The border, labels, icons, and styles used to decorate a Material Design text field. These three widgets earlier. Create a button to validate and submit the form How does this work? Interactive example Apps. Wrap with Form, add formKey then just trigger the validation with the button. and remove all textAlign property. save will invoke each FormField 's onSaved. fromLTRB(12,10, 4, 5), child: Text('+91 ')),. After you get the String data from your database, you can simply do : final Correo = TextEditingController (); Correo. Provides requirement of the field. Creating a dropdown. 0. In this article, you will learn how to build a basic Flutter form, style it, and validate the user input. Add a Button widget and then. This is a convenience widget that wraps a DropdownButton widget in a. If the required. class CheckBoxFormField extends FormField<bool> { @override. class MyCustomFormState extends State<MyCustomForm> { final _formKey = GlobalKey<FormState> (); @override Widget build (BuildContext context) { // Build a Form widget using the. See the below code: TextFormField (. 2. Just wrap TextFormField with Padding and give EdgeInsets. I want Result like this:-My curent ui look like this:-Here is my code:-Flutter : TextFormField onchange value to Text widget. My issue is how to remove the extra space between the decorator labelText like Gender and the dropdown button labeled "Male". The Checkbox itself does toggle between true and false but there is no change in the layout. More. 17. I want Result like this:-My curent ui look like this:-Here is my code:- Im new, I trying to do a onchange value while typing in text field, the value are updating the Text widget. dropDownList # dropDownList,List of dropdown. You could check out my app. [. If I remove the parent-most Expanded widget the keyboard flashes upward for a moment. Follows the app theme and colors. Ask Question. dependencies: flutter: sdk: flutter intl: ^0. By default, in our app we can't give user a default value, that's why validation is needed. We’ve also used set state inside the function passed to onChanged constructor. 3. so previously the child of Padding widget is TextFormField but in my. – Ankit Tale. More than 100 million people use GitHub to discover, fork, and contribute to over 330 million projects. const EdgeInsets. new Form( autovalidate: true, child: new ListBody( children: <Widget>[ new TextFormField( decoration: const Input. 3 Answers. Create a new dart file called DateTimePicker. For that we’re going to use DropdownButtonFormField for the months and years. Also included are common ready-made form input fields for FormBuilder. How-ever, there could be space-problem depending on fontSize + etc. To show on the click of a button, in the Dropdown Button we have initialized some list items. or simple place this code in onChanged () method of textfield. Flutter forms provide a simple and intuitive way to collect such information from users on your Flutter application. i removed the height though, and used an InputDecoration(contentPadding: EdgeInsets. dart from the Flutter Framework and paste it into your own project as fixed_dropdown. 2. 1 Answer. Wrap your TextFormField inside the IgnorePointer widget. Line 22 where we see FocusScope. Twitter Reddit LinkedIn Pinterest. Add Text(Form)Field input to a list. DropdownMenuItem. Improve this question. 2. A customised Flutter TextFormField to input international phone number along with country code. Just Simply Add this dropdown to your code and simply import flutter_form_builder to your code. To create a local project with this code sample, run: flutter create --sample=material. T. Simple and intuitive to use in the app. TextFormField + DropdownButton as a suffix child. none for border attribute. You could use a focus node: myFocusNode = FocusNode () Add it to your TextFormField: TextFormField ( focusNode: myFocusNode,. I decided not to force the issue. A Form ancestor is not required. 本記事では、ドロップダウン(プルダウン)のボタンの表示に役立つWidget、. 0.